Direct linear relationships occur when two variables are directly proportional, whereas indirect linear relationships occur when two variables are inversely proportional.
The constant of proportionality is used in various real-world applications, including finance, healthcare, and engineering. For example, it can be used to calculate the cost of materials needed for a construction project or to predict the number of customers a business can expect based on its marketing efforts.

What is the difference between direct and indirect linear relationships?
A direct linear relationship exists when two variables are directly proportional to each other, meaning that as one variable increases, the other variable also increases at a consistent rate. The constant of proportionality, often denoted by the letter 'k', is a numerical value that represents the rate of change between the two variables.
